Most flowering plants can achieve pollination in several different ways. Those that produce pollen and carpels on the same plant may be self-pollinated, but they may also be cross-pollinated by insects or other pollinators. WebJan 30, 2024 · Each type of bee in the hive has some special parts to help them in their role. Queen – long abdomen to hold large ovaries and store semen. Drone – large eggs to see queens in flight, penis and semen. Worker – honey crop to collect nectar, pollen baskets for pollen, stinger, wax glands. WebFeb 10, 2024 · Here are seven types of beehives to keep your busy bees safe and sound. 1. Langstroth Hive. In the mid 19th century, Rev. Langstroth, from Philadelphia, invented the Langstroth hive and revolutionized beekeeping. One hundred and fifty years later, this beehive is still the most commonly used type of hive in the United States ( 1 ). WebCommon Types of Bees.
